Each of the following heat engines is missing one of the three energy flows necessary. Explain why each one is physically impossible or otherwise undesirable. (a) (b) (c)

Solution

Case 1.

The first case is physically impossible because with out any heat gain from higher reservoir how a heat engine produced work.This is practically or physically impossible.

Case 2.

The second case also be physically impossible because It is impossible to construct a device which operating on a single reservoir and continously producing work.Minimum two reservoir is compulsory for produce work.because

!!There is nothing like a 100% efficient heat engine!!

Perpetual motion machine of the second kind is not possible.

Case 3.

The third case is undesirable. because in third case the heat is gain from higher temperature reservoir totaly goes to lower reservoir there zero work produce so that such kind of heat engine is undesirable which is not producing work or we can se who zero efficiency.
